- Series: K-State now leads the all-time series with Texas, 16-10. For the first time in the series, Texas and K-State played three times in one season.
- Starters: Myck Kabongo, Sheldon McClellan, Ioannis Papapetrou, Jonathan Holmes and Cameron Ridley started on Thursday. It is the first starting lineup change for Texas since Kabongo's return on Feb. 13 against Iowa State.
- Big 12 Championship: Texas falls to 22-17 in its 17th appearance in the Phillips 66 Big 12 Championship, including a 14-12 mark in games played in Kansas City, Mo. The Longhorns are 16-5 in the First and Quarterfinal rounds of the Championship.
- Julien Lewis led the Longhorns in scoring for the eighth time this season with 13 points on 3-of-6 shooting from 3-point range ... reached double figures in scoring for the 17th time this season and 27th time of his career (64 games).
- Jonathan Holmes reached double figures in scoring (10 points) for the eighth time this season and first time since scoring 10 points agianst Kansas on Jan. 19 ... shot 3-of-4 from the floor and 3-of-4 at the free throw line.
- Cameron Ridley recorded six points on three dunks ... grabbed four offensive rebounds in 17 minutes.
